Transportation Details

Private transportation in modern, high-end cars takes visitors from their chosen pickup location in Paris, whether it’s a hotel, restaurant, or other spot, to the Versailles palace.
The return trip can be to the original or an alternate location, providing flexibility. The service is wheelchair accessible, and stroller and infant seats are available, catering to the needs of diverse travelers.
Clear communication about transportation arrangements is essential, as past experiences have noted some challenges with pickup and guide coordination.
The operator emphasizes a commitment to improving communication and service quality to ensure a seamless experience for all.

Excursion Itinerary

The excursion whisks visitors through the resplendent halls of Versailles, immersing them in the grandeur of French royal history.
The carefully curated itinerary includes:
- Guided tour of the Palace of Versailles, exploring the opulent State Apartments and the iconic Hall of Mirrors
- Stroll through the magnificent gardens, admiring the intricate fountains and geometric designs
- Visit to the Grand Trianon, a private retreat for French monarchs
- Exploration of the Petit Trianon, where Marie Antoinette once entertained guests
- Optional visit to the Queen’s Hamlet, a picturesque village built for the queen’s private enjoyment
